Airport Information

Charlotte (CLT)

Charlotte Douglas International Airport (CLT) serves as a primary fortress hub for American Airlines, offering a streamlined experience despite its high volume of passengers. Located just west of downtown Charlotte, it features a unique central atrium with rocking chairs where travelers can relax. The airport is currently undergoing major expansions under its 'Destination CLT' program, which continues to improve gate capacity and terminal amenities for domestic travelers.

Minneapolis (MSP)

Minneapolis-Saint Paul International Airport (MSP) is a major hub for Delta Air Lines and is frequently ranked as one of the best airports in North America for customer service and efficiency. It consists of two terminals, Terminal 1 (Lindbergh) and Terminal 2 (Humphrey), which are connected by a light rail service. Passengers can enjoy a wide variety of local dining options and high-end shopping while waiting for ground transportation to either city center.

Frequently Asked Questions

Which airlines offer direct flights from CLT to MSP?

American Airlines and Delta Air Lines are the primary carriers providing non-stop service between these two major hubs.

How long is the flight from Charlotte to Minneapolis?

A typical direct flight lasts approximately 2 hours and 45 minutes to 3 hours, covering a distance of about 930 miles.

Is there a time difference between Charlotte and Minneapolis?

Yes, Charlotte is in the Eastern Time Zone, while Minneapolis is in the Central Time Zone, meaning Minneapolis is one hour behind Charlotte.

What is the best way to get from MSP to downtown Minneapolis?

The Metro Transit Blue Line light rail offers a convenient and affordable connection from both terminals directly to downtown Minneapolis in about 25 minutes.

Are there lounge options at CLT for passengers on this route?

Yes, passengers can access several American Airlines Admirals Clubs, a Centurion Lounge, and The Club CLT depending on their membership or ticket class.
